Strong dark Belgian ideas from mixed grains

So I have a bucket of the following grains, which have already been milled and are mixed together. (Long story, but involves disastrous units conversions.)

6.38 lb pilsener malt (38.5%)
4.5 lb aromatic malt (27.1%)
4.75 lb carapils (28.7%)
0.9 lb Munich malt (5.7%)

It’s obviously a ton of aromatic malt and carapils, but I want to try to salvage some of these grains. My idea is to make a Belgian quad, using half of the grains and adding another ~7 pounds of pilsener malt, a little more Munich malt, and some various Belgian candi sugars. For an OG of 1.104, I would still be at 10% carapils and 9.6% aromatic malt. (This is based very loosely on ideas for Rochefort 10 clones I’ve seen on a few forums.)

In general, I’m wondering if this could possibly turn into a good beer? I know the carapils is unfermentable, but it seems like it might work okay in this style. Is there something else you would recommend brewing with this odd mix of grains? All ideas welcome!

A quad is a bad place to use much crystal malts, period.  Belgian beers are supposed to be highly attenuated.  So you really don’t want to add anything that will INCREASE the body and DECREASE attenuation.  Especially in a quad, where the OG is so high.  The yeast can only attenuate so far, percentage-wise.  You don’t want to end up with a final gravity of like 1.030, right?!  So don’t use much crystal malt, if at all, IMHO.

The comment about cherry candy also applies to the aromatic malt.  In high quantities, at least in my mind, aromatic malt has a certain cherry-like fruitiness that can easily get carried away.  You don’t want to use too much of it.

I don’t think that is quite right. Cara/crystal malts are more or less fully converted. The process of making cara/crystal malt is to essentially mash the whole kernel and then kiln to the desired color. The sugar is not convertible because it is already converted, otherwise they would just add starch which is not sweet at all. I have read experiments that seemed to indicate that crystal malt in the lighter color range are actually fairly fermentable while the darker ones are less so. This also has a lot to do with your choice of yeast and that yeasts ability to effectively metabolize those longer chain more complex sugars.

so in short, I don’t think there is a simple rule you can follow or calculation you can perform easily.

You could build out some charts for your favorite yeast through empiric method. Mini mash a bunch of 1 quart batches with a handful of pilsner malt and varying amounts of carapils, or mix up the color crystals and do one with carapils, one with c10, c20, c40… etc.

mash all at the same temp and time and pitch the same amount of the same yeast. you get the idea

So, for what it’s worth, I’ve done a ton of reading on what various enzymes do to break down starches and dextrins, as well as the process of malting and kilning and how that converts sugars, both fermentable and unfermentable. I now realize Carapils is very different from Crystal malts - somehow (it’s proprietary), Carapils ends up with a bunch of “enzyme-resistant dextrins” that cannot be broken down in the mash… but I’m not sure why. Like marticaivxavier said, Crystals do have fermentables, with progressively fewer as you get darker (having to do with the higher kilning temps).

Now I’m starting to look into whether there’s a way of adding extra debranching enzymes to a mash, as I have a feeling that would enable the breakdown of certain dextrins that branch off the long glucose chains. Perhaps Carapils is full of short branching dextrins, which could become fermentable if mashed with the right enzymes. The only style where it might make sense to use a large portion of that mix in one beer is if you plan on souring it because the brett and pedio will break down the maltodextrin from carapils. Not sure how that much aromatic would taste in a sour but the cherry note wouldn’t be out of place.
